I am facing problems in determining the cause of low TR (Tons of Refrigeration) in a VAM (Vapor Absorption Machine) installed to utilise low grade heat from excess steam.

The data are as follows :

 

Model : Single Effect Vapor Absorption Chiller Steam Driven - Thermax India

 

Design TR : 500

It is supplying chilled water to 3 chillers .

 

 Chilled water    

         

TR1 144.79    

TR2 128.47    

TR3 145.24  

Totalised TR  418.5 2

        

Tin °C 16.1  

Tout °C 9.33  

Flow 1 m3/hr 62.75  

Flow 2 m3/hr 65.28  

Flow 3 m3/hr 62.75  

Total Flow m3/hr 190.78    

   

Vacuum mm Hg 7 

 

Steam                      

T °C 114        

Flow m3/hr 2553.79        

 

Cooling Water      

       

Tin °C 29.3  

Tout °C 35.5        

       

LiBr    

         

Generator Temp. °C 98  

LiBr Spray Temp. °C 65.44  

Conc. % 63.5

 

Can Someone having experience in dealing with VAM Systems suggest solutions !!
